Critically acclaimed comedian Jamali Maddix is back on the road with a brand new tour show, Aston.
Expect Jamali's trademark brutally honest and unflinching perspectives on the world at large. His last tours have sold-out shows across the globe, playing the UK, Europe, Asia, Australia, and North America.
He is a regular on the series of Nevermind the Buzzcocks for Sky and was one of the most anarchic Taskmaster contestants the show has ever seen. Alongside this he was a regular contributor for Frankie Boyle's New World Order (BBC 2) and has been seen on Live at the Apollo (BBC 2), 8 Out of 10 Cats (More4), The Late Late Show with James Corden (CBS) as well as many others.
